まとめ
ヒトの細胞はミミクリを使って ウイルスと戦うことができます 研究者はRBBP6という ウイルスの複製因子を標的として ウイルスの成分を模倣するタンパク質を発見しました

背景:
- エボラウイルスなどのウイルスは 宿主細胞の機械を分子模倣で利用します
- 宿主と病原体の相互作用を理解することは,抗ウイルス戦略の開発に不可欠です.
研究 の 目的:
- エボラウイルスの複製を制限する新しい宿主因子を特定する.
- 抗ウイルスメカニズムとして 細胞模倣の可能性を調査する
主な方法:
- エボラウイルスの細胞相互作用の特徴.
- ホストの制限因子の特定と機能分析
- タンパク質とタンパク質の相互作用とミミクリーのメカニズムを決定する生化学的測定.
主要な成果:
- 新しい抗ウイルス抑制因子RBBP6が特定されました.
- RBBP6はエボラウイルスの転写因子VP30を標的としています.
- RBBP6は,エボラウイルスの核タンパク質の結合インターフェースを模倣して機能します.
結論:
- 人間の細胞は ウイルスの感染を抑制するために 模倣を用いることができます
- RBBP6は,分子模倣を用いた新しい抗ウイルス因子のクラスです.
- ホスト・ミミクリによるウイルスの転写因子を標的にすることは,潜在的な抗ウイルス治療の道を提供します.
